SUMMARY:Forest Bathing
DESCRIPTION:Coined shinrin-yoku in Japan in the 1980’s\, forest bathing is the eco therapeutic practice of spending time immersed in nature\, absorbing it with all your senses. The physiological and psychological benefits last for days afterward with the additional benefit of a new appreciation of our precious woodland and its inhabitants. This is a beginner-rated walk along the Nature Trail with long pauses to sit and enhance our awareness of our surroundings\, it is an approximately 1-hour program. A small mat is beneficial to ensure a dry seat and wear warmer clothes as we will be sitting for longer periods of time. This program is limited to those age 14 and up. SUMMARY:Stonewall Trail Hike
DESCRIPTION:This is a guided hike on a lesser-known trail along the Hudson River with the added interest of logging history and old foundations. This 3.5-mile hike has some steeper parts. Meet at the office and convoy or carpool to the trailhead. Please wear the appropriate attire for the weather- sunscreen\, bug spray and water-resistant hiking shoes.
